LEADHER Grants
The LEADHER programme will provide a limited number of grants to
applicants who have submitted a project proposal explaining why and
how, working in collaboration with a specific partner institution, they
wish to address an area of needed institutional reform. The
proposal will justify the choice of partner institutions and describe
any previous collaboration that may have taken place.
Each proposal will outline general and specific reform objectives being
pursued by the institutions and explain what activities and actions are
being taken to meet these goals. The proposal will explain how
the LEADHER project fits into this implementation strategy and offer
details such as the rationale for the partnership, objectives to be met
collaboratively, proposed activities, expected outcomes and follow-up
as well as financial considerations.
LEADHER grants are awarded
to partnership proposals on a competitive basis. They will
provide modest financial support to the project so that it can be
carried out in a specific timeframe.
